Types of Bariatric Surgery Procedures



Learn more about the various types of bariatric surgical treatment treatments available to help you make an informed decision regarding your weight loss journey.

One of the most usual kinds of bariatric surgeries include:
- Stomach bypass entails developing a smaller sized stomach pouch and rerouting the intestines to limit food intake and nutrient absorption.
- Sleeve gastrectomy minimizes the belly's size by eliminating a big section of it, limiting the amount of food you can eat.
- The adjustable stomach band involves positioning a band around the tummy to create a little pouch, promoting very early satiation.
- Biliopancreatic diversion with duodenal switch integrates a sleeve gastrectomy with a significant bypass of the intestinal tracts, leading to both constraint and malabsorption.

Each sort of surgical procedure has its advantages and considerations, so it's essential to speak with your healthcare provider to figure out one of the most suitable choice for your individual demands.

Risks and Complications to Think about



Recognizing the prospective dangers and issues connected with bariatric surgery is crucial before making a decision about going through the treatment. While bariatric surgical procedure can be a life-altering option for excessive weight, it is very important to be knowledgeable about the prospective difficulties that might occur.

Complications such as infections, embolism, and negative responses to anesthetic can occur throughout or after the surgical procedure. Sometimes, leaks in the stomach system or bowel obstructions might also happen, requiring prompt clinical focus. Nutritional shortages are one more worry post-surgery, as the body may have problem soaking up vital nutrients.


In addition, there's a threat of gallstones, ulcers, and also mental concerns such as clinical depression or body photo worries. It's necessary to discuss these risks extensively with your healthcare provider and to comprehend the prospective difficulties that may arise to make an enlightened decision regarding bariatric surgical procedure.

Advantages and Expected Outcomes



Take into consideration the benefits and anticipated outcomes of bariatric surgical procedure to obtain an extensive understanding of the positive results you may achieve. One of the primary advantages is considerable weight reduction, which can bring about boosted general health and wellness and a decreased danger of obesity-related problems such as diabetic issues, cardiovascular disease, and sleep apnea. Bariatric surgery can likewise boost your lifestyle by boosting mobility, minimizing joint pain, and boosting self-esteem and confidence.

In addition, this surgical procedure frequently leads to a marked enhancement in obesity-related comorbidities. Several individuals experience a decrease in blood pressure, cholesterol levels, and insulin resistance post-surgery. In addition, bariatric treatments have shown to have a positive impact on psychological health, with a decrease in clinical depression and stress and anxiety signs generally reported.

In regards to expected outcomes, many individuals commonly see fast weight loss in the very first few months after surgical procedure, with proceeded progression over the following year.

It's important to keep in mind that while bariatric surgery can be a powerful device for weight loss, long-term success hinges on dedication to way of living modifications and follow-up treatment.
